Description Olanzapine N-Oxide is a metabolite of Olanzapine which shows antipsychotic activity.
molecular weight 328.43
Molecular formula C17H20N4OS
CAS 174794-02-6
Storage store at low temperature |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year | Shipping with blue ice.
Solubility DMSO: 3.28 mg/mL (10 mM)
